History of American Rebels

Many people ask how  we came up with the idea for our first T-shirt "My rebel flag".

    Coming back from a trip to Florida Jimbo went through South Carolina.  He was very pleased to see the citizens of that state flying the flag of their heritage (Confederate Battle Flag) despite the liberal news medias attack on them and their flag.  When Jimbo made it back to Indiana he relayed what he had seen to his brother, Bob.  While telling this to his brother, Jimbo commented he would like to see all Americans show that same pride in the original rebels ( the Founding Fathers) and their flag.  Our first flag with thirteen stars (Betsy Ross) symbolized rebellion for freedom and a belief in self-destiny.  So Jimbo and Bob put the "My rebel flag" shirt together and started showing it to others.  Not a negative word was said about the idea. They decided to get a few shirts printed up. When they had sold that whole batch before they were even off the screeners press they thought they might be onto something.
